Additionally, the more channels, selections and higher the quality, the larger your file will be. Also, your setup may have issues with playing files with 7.1 DTS-HD or other high quality sound outputs. Many BluRays include Director’s Commentary, so you want to beware of choosing these unless you actually want them included. MakeMKV – Choose your preferred audio SetupĪudio: If the Title Selection wasn’t tricky enough, now you have to figure out what audio channel outputs you want. Once you’ve found the right file, check the box and expand the arrow next to it. If you’re not sure, you can also pop the disc into a player and see how many chapters it has and how long it is. Usually, the largest file is the movie (but not always!). You should be able to find the correct film (or episode) by looking at the length of the film, or by referencing the file size. As you’ll often find multiple files listed. The Title Selection screen can be a bit tricky here.
